SCL icon

Stepan Co

214 hedge funds and large institutions have $1.54B invested in Stepan Co in 2024 Q2 according to their latest regulatory filings, with 33 funds opening new positions, 72 increasing their positions, 70 reducing their positions, and 15 closing their positions.

Holders
214
Holders Change
+16
Holders Change %
+8.08%
% of All Funds
3.11%
Holding in Top 10
Holding in Top 10 Change
Holding in Top 10 Change %
% of All Funds
New
33
Increased
72
Reduced
70
Closed
15
Calls
$864K
Puts
Net Calls
+$864K
Net Calls Change
-$451K
Name Holding Trade Value Shares
Change
Shares
Change %
CCM
226
Copeland Capital Management
Pennsylvania
-$41.1K -456 Closed
PWMG
227
Private Wealth Management Group
New Jersey
-$1.26K -14 Closed
TWP
228
TFO Wealth Partners
Ohio
-$90 -1 Closed